Here are some highlights of the five main topics within Financial Accounting.
The first section is completely introductory in nature. The course does not assume any prerequisites, and the first phrase will teach learners all about the financial statements, about accounting principles, and about the utility of the balance sheet. This can be skimmed through by learners who already have a deep knowledge of P&L and Balance Sheet topics; it will be extremely useful for those who come to the course from different disciplines, and for those who wish to refresh their knowledge with the latest conventions in the field.
The second segment focuses on how to accurately record and document transactions. Every financial transaction can be of many different types, and each transaction, irrespective of its value, must be recorded with multiple tags and fields. This section does two things: it teaches all the different rules to keep in mind so as to accurately document incoming and outgoing values, while also equipping learners with information regarding the softwares which are used to record these data.
The third section deals with the Income Statement. This is usually the section of Financial Accounting that has the most adjustments on a quarterly and annual basis, and the course will answer all the doubts that learners usually have about ambiguities and edge cases. Revenue and Expense transactions will be classified in detail, and the previous section (on recording and documenting transactions) will take on its complete significance in the context of the Income Statement. Finally, this section will also cover important topics related to adjusting entries, and the conventions to be kept in mind so that all adjustments are in compliance with accounting principles while being completely clear for future professionals who will read the Income Statement.
The fourth main section is related to the Preparation of Financial Statements. This is probably the most lucrative part of the Financial Accounting Value Chain, with audit accounting bringing in billions of dollars across the world annually. The Statement of Cash Flows and the verification of each entry will be the key modules within this section; after the end of this, learners will be ready to take their place as senior accounting professionals, and they will have successfully completed their goal to learn accounting online.
Finally, the course ends with a series of topics on high level comprehensive analysis of annual reports and financial statements. This is crucial to learn how big companies expect end-to-end accounting, and you will receive Accounting Training across multiple dimensions, including the preparation of Notes to Accounts, financial statement scrutiny, external audits, and answering questions by shareholders and investors.
